Community Services Traineeship (Certificate III) x 2 Positions

Location Liverpool or Campbelltown

Duration Full-time, 12-month fixed term with the potential for extension

About the Role:

This full-time traineeship is a great opportunity for someone who’s looking to build a career in Community Services. You’ll work alongside experienced professionals while completing your Certificate III in Community Services, gaining hands-on experience in supporting individuals and engaging with the local community.

Key Responsibilities:

• Greeting participants upon their arrival

• Assisting participants with scheduling appointments, job search, and any general enquiries

• Entering data into various systems

• Drafting resumes for participants

• Maintain confidentiality and adhere to internal policies and procedures

• Support the team with administrative tasks, data entry, reporting, inbound and outbound calling

About You:

• Enthusiastic about helping others and making a difference with a people-focused approach

• Eager to learn and committed to completing the Certificate III in Community Services

• Strong communication and interpersonal skills

• Organised, reliable, and a team player

• Professional and friendly phone manner

• Basic computer literacy (Microsoft Office, email, online forms)

• No prior experience required

• Recent HSC graduates are encouraged to apply

• Be willing to provide a satisfactory Criminal Record Check, Working with Children Check and other checks as deemed necessary

• Be eligible to work in Australia

• Be able to work full-time hours onsite, Monday to Friday

Eligibility

To be eligible for this traineeship, you must:

• Hold Australian work rights

• Not already hold a qualification equal to or higher than Certificate III in Community Services

• Be able to commit to full-time work and study

About Global Skills Employment Services

Global Skills opened its doors in 1990 and has steadily grown into a network of employment service offices across the Greater Sydney region.

For over three decades we have proudly served and connected tens of thousands of job seekers across Greater Sydney with a diverse range of employers who are committed to build their workforce from within their local communities.

Now operating in 24 locations, Global Skills has built a reputation as a strong performing and collaborative provider across a number of core programs including Workforce Australia, inclusive of Transition to Work and Career Transition Assistance Employment Services and Disability Employment Services.

With now over 200 staff employed, Global Skills is delivering on our mission to provide innovative employment services that make a ‘world of difference’ to our communities.
